I read that the trail would be closed from Metcalf Road to Bailey Ave. 10/5-8 for installation of culverts. Fortunately, construction was complete when we got there, and the trail was open. We got to see the newly-installed culverts. I saw they were in a part of the trail that gets frequently flooded when the Coyote Creek flow is high. Sometimes it results in trail closure. Even when it's not closed, the wet trail can be a safety hazard. I saw a bicyclist who was injured in an accident due to the slippery trail surface. Coyote Creek has been dry for months, and ponds along the creek are dry or low. It's an ideal time to do work to improve drainage and prevent trail flooding. The culverts should allow water to flow under the trail instead of over it.
